Red Bull – Explore The Mean Streets Of Paraguay w/ Tyler Surrey & Crew | HEARTBEATS TO HEAVEN TOUR Part 2
Having said goodbye to the local skaters of the Paraguayan capital Asunción, Red Bull’s intrepid skateboard squadron of Tyler Surrey, Giovanni Vianna, Max Habanec and Angelo Caro hit the road once again towards the city of Ciudad del Este on the Paraguayan side of the country’s triple border with both Brazil and Argentina.
The city was bustling with activity; people were selling and buying stuff everywhere and like everywhere else in Paraguay, the ground was super-rough.

Skate Paraguay with Angelo Caro, Tyler Surrey & Crew | HEARTBEATS TO HEAVEN TOUR Part 1
Paraguay isn’t the most conventional destination to go on a skate tour. Located in the heart of South America, this small but welcoming country of around seven million people experienced its first ever pro skate tour recently, when for 12 days a crew consisting of Angelo Caro, Maxim Habanec, Tyler Surrey and Giovanni Vianna touched down to meet the local skaters who’ve created their own tiny, but ripping, skate-scene. Stop Four: Minneapolis, Minnesota | Red Bull CORNERSTONE 2019 – Red Bull
All roads lead to Minneapolis as the first annual Red Bull Cornerstone series came to an end this past weekend. Familia HQ, widely considered the gem of the Midwest, hosted the 4th and final Qualifier event on Saturday where the top 6 men and top 3 women of the day advanced to join pre-qualified skaters from the Lincoln, Kansas City, and St. Louis stops in the the Series Finals on Sunday.
Saturday’s Qualifier was the biggest event of the series with nearly 70 competitors turning out. Once again, skaters from surrounding states and beyond made the journey for their last chance at clinching a spot in Sunday’s Finals. Cornerstone is one of the only contests in the U.S. where amateur skaters can earn some serious cash, and with $15,000 up for grabs, no place in the nation is too far away. Just ask Kristin Ebeling who flew in from Seattle, WA just for the contest! A very wise decision by her as it turns out. When the dust finally settled after a hard fought contest on Saturday, it was Minneapolis locals Jonathon Reese, Logan Mozey, and Benny Milam in the top spots for men’s, and Dana Jeck, Kristin Ebeling, and Deej Redoble on the podium for women’s.
